For people that are curious:
The Mighty Mo G1000 was a late 60's tractor. It was powered by a MM 6 cylinder engine. 8.3L 6 cyl engine, well past the 500 cubic inch mark. Rated around 100 drawbar HP. Obviously, being a 6-10 ton tractor(depends on weights) HP is not really measured for it like you would a car. Redline is probably somewhere around 1900 RPM.
This one they have is pretty rare. They made a smidge over 7000 of the G1000 over 4-5 years, most were diesel, most were not wheatland. Lots of people would ditch the cab because it is a tin noisebox, but that has made factory cabs super rare too. This tractor in good form will freeking CHUG like a train. Mighty Mo diesles roll black smoke enough to make any cummins/duramax millenial wet their pants. I doubt the LP version will, but it will still chug like a son of a b.
When this tractor was built, White(made trucks) had owned them and Oliver, and Cockshutt(mostly Canada). After this tractor, they combined this engine with Olivers transmission and made a G1050 and G1350. There weren't hardly any painted yellow though.

I am familiar with these because I grew up with and now own my Grandpa's(then my Dad's, and now mine) '65 MM U302. Tractors like this can sit for 40 years and fire up with an afternoons work, provided they weren't parked because of a breakdown. There's no computers to fail.
